RBD系统在云计算环境中的应用研究性能优化与安全保障探究

  • 搭配技巧
  • 2024年11月06日
  • RBD系统在云计算环境中的应用研究:性能优化与安全保障探究 引言 随着云计算技术的快速发展,分布式存储系统成为支持大规模数据中心运作不可或缺的组成部分。RBD(RADOS Block Device),作为Ceph分布式存储系统中的一种块设备,可以提供高效、可靠的数据存储服务。本文旨在探讨RBD在云计算环境中的应用情况,特别是其性能优化和安全保障方面的问题。 RBD概述

RBD系统在云计算环境中的应用研究性能优化与安全保障探究

RBD系统在云计算环境中的应用研究:性能优化与安全保障探究

引言

随着云计算技术的快速发展,分布式存储系统成为支持大规模数据中心运作不可或缺的组成部分。RBD(RADOS Block Device),作为Ceph分布式存储系统中的一种块设备,可以提供高效、可靠的数据存储服务。本文旨在探讨RBD在云计算环境中的应用情况,特别是其性能优化和安全保障方面的问题。

RBD概述

RBD是一种面向对象的块设备接口,它允许用户通过标准的block I/O操作来访问分布式文件系统。这种设计使得RBD能够轻松地集成到各种上层软件中,如虚拟机监控程序(Hypervisor)和容器运行时。同时,由于其基于对象模型,RBD具有很强的地理分散性和数据冗余能力,使其适合构建高可用、高扩展性的分布式存储解决方案。

性能优化策略

为了提高RBD在云计算环境下的性能,我们可以采取以下几个策略:

资源调度:通过有效地调配节点资源,如CPU、内存和网络带宽,可以最大化单个I/O请求处理能力。

读写缓冲区:使用合适大小的读写缓冲区可以减少对物理介质的直接操作次数,从而提升I/O性能。

数据复制策略:根据实际需求调整副本数量,以平衡持久性与性能之间的关系。

集群拓扑设计:合理规划集群拓扑结构以降低网络延迟,并且确保关键路径上的节点均衡配置。

安全保障措施

为了保证RBD在云计算环境下的安全性,我们需要实施以下措施:

加密传输:对所有跨节点传输的大型数据块进行加密,以防止中途泄露敏感信息。

身份验证与授权:严格控制客户端与服务器之间通信过程中的身份验证,以及对不同用户权限级别进行精细授权。

备份与恢复机制:建立定期自动备份机制,并确保有完整且可行的事故恢复计划,以防突发事件导致重要数据丢失。

实践案例分析

我们选取了一些成功应用了RBD技术的小型企业IT部门进行案例分析。在这些企业中,通过采用自定义配置并结合现有的硬件资源,实现了成本效益显著,同时保持了业务连续性不受影响。

结论

总结来说,虽然存在一些挑战,但通过对比分析发现,当正确配置并运维良好的条件下,Rbd能够为云平台提供稳定、高效以及经济实惠的手段。这表明,在未来的几年里,大规模采用rbd可能会成为cloud storage领域的一个趋势。

猜你喜欢